Understanding Endurance Training: Objectives and Methods
Endurance training is a discipline geared towards enhancing an individual’s ability to engage in prolonged physical activities. The primary objectives of this type of training include improving oxygen consumption, increasing muscle efficiency, and expanding cardiovascular capacity to delay fatigue. A well-designed endurance program typically incorporates a variety of training methods such as steady-state cardio, interval training, and tempo runs to stimulate adaptations in the body that contribute to increased endurance. These methods can range from long-distance running to cycling, swimming, or even high-intensity workouts with recovery periods.
